From owner-FreeBSD-users-jp@jp.freebsd.org  Wed Apr 22 02:16:45 1998
Received: by jaz.jp.freebsd.org (8.8.8+3.0Wbeta7/8.7.3) id CAA08544
	Wed, 22 Apr 1998 02:16:45 +0900 (JST)
Received: by jaz.jp.freebsd.org (8.8.8+3.0Wbeta7/8.7.3) with ESMTP id CAA08537
	for <FreeBSD-users-jp@jp.freebsd.org>; Wed, 22 Apr 1998 02:16:44 +0900 (JST)
Received: from rayearth.rim.or.jp (rayearth.rim.or.jp [202.247.130.242]) by ns11.rim.or.jp (8.8.5/3.5Wpl2-ns11/RIMNET-2) with ESMTP
	id CAA02479 for <FreeBSD-users-jp@jp.freebsd.org>; Wed, 22 Apr 1998 02:16:42 +0900 (JST)
Received: (from uucp@localhost) by rayearth.rim.or.jp (8.8.5/3.5Wpl2-uucp1/RIMNET) with UUCP
	id CAA18610 for FreeBSD-users-jp@jp.freebsd.org; Wed, 22 Apr 1998 02:16:42 +0900 (JST)
Received: from localhost (localhost [127.0.0.1]) by red.snark.rim.or.jp (8.8.7/3.5Wpl7-98011205) with ESMTP id BAA11871 for <FreeBSD-users-jp@jp.freebsd.org>; Wed, 22 Apr 1998 01:38:31 +0900 (JST)
To: FreeBSD-users-jp@jp.freebsd.org
From: "Shin'ya Kumabuchi" <kumabu@t3.rim.or.jp>
In-Reply-To: Your message of "Tue, 21 Apr 1998 11:37:36 +0900 (JST)"
	<199804210237.LAA14064@sparc.wtank.csk.co.jp>
References: <199804210237.LAA14064@sparc.wtank.csk.co.jp>
X-Mailer: Mew version 1.87 on Emacs 19.28.2 / Mule 2.3
Mime-Version: 1.0
Content-Type: Text/Plain; charset=iso-2022-jp
Content-Transfer-Encoding: 7bit
Message-Id: <19980422013831I.kumabu@t3.rim.or.jp>
Date: Wed, 22 Apr 1998 01:38:31 +0900
X-Dispatcher: imput version 970728
Lines: 112
Reply-To: FreeBSD-users-jp@jp.freebsd.org
Precedence: bulk
X-Distribute: distribute [version 2.1 (Alpha) patchlevel=24]
X-Sequence: FreeBSD-users-jp 27482
Subject: [FreeBSD-users-jp 27482] Re: Install teikade w/t JDK1.1.5
Errors-To: owner-FreeBSD-users-jp@jp.freebsd.org
Sender: owner-FreeBSD-users-jp@jp.freebsd.org

$B$/$^$V$A$G$9!#(B

$B!|!{(B $B;d$N5-21$,3N$+$J$i!"(B"Tue, 21 Apr 1998 11:37:36 +0900 (JST)" $B:"(B ...
$B!|!{(B Yoshiyuki Karezaki <kare@wtank.csk.co.jp> $B$5$s$O=q$-$^$7$?!#(B

>  |$B$3$A$i$NJ}$b!"(BonSolaris $BJQ?t$r(B true $B$K$9$k%k!<%H$KN.$9$h$&$K$7$?$b$N$H(B
>  |$BF~$l49$($F$_$?$N$G$9$,!"LdBjE@$,0c$&$+$bCN$l$J$$$H$$$&0KAR$5$s$N$4;XE&(B
>  |$BDL$j!"FC$KJQ2=$O$J$+$C$?$G$9!#(B

> $BB?J,!$$=$N2<$NJ}$K$"$k(B onJDK1_1 $BJQ?t$b(B true $B$K$9$kI,MW$,$"$k$N$8$c$J$$(B
> $B$G$7$g$&$+!)(B
> $B$3$A$i$O!$0J2<$N=$@5$GF0:n$7$F$$$k$h$&$G$9!%(B

$B$"$j$,$H$&$4$6$$$^$9!"rW:j$5$s$N(B patch $B$G%P%C%A%jF0$+$9$3$H$,$G$-$^$7(B
$B$?!#(B

teikade $B$r3+H/$J$5$C$?(B PFU $B$5$s$NJ}$K%a%$%k$7$F$*$-$^$7$?$,!"(BQ&A $B$K$b(B
$BAw$C$F$*$$$?J}$,$$$$$N$+$J$!(B?

$B$H$j$"$($:(B Q&A $B$K$9$k$J$i$3$s$J46$8$+$J!"$H;W$&$N$G$9$,!"3+H/85$KBP=h(B
$B$7$F$$$?$@$1$l$PITMW$N$b$N$G$9$M!D(B

------------------------------------------------------------
Q.
  JDK 1.1.? $B$N4D6-$G(B teikade $B$r%$%s%9%H!<%k$7$h$&$H$7$F$$$^$9$,!"$&$^(B
$B$/$$$-$^$;$s!#(B
  % java Setup $B$r9T$C$F$b!"(BPackage setup $B$N%U%l!<%`$O8=$l$k$N$G$9$,!"(B
$B$=$N$^$^8G$^$C$F$7$^$$$^$9!#(B

A.
  $B%$%s%9%H!<%k$7$h$&$H$7$F$$$k(B teikade $B$,(B teikade-1.8R2-src.tar.gz $B$N(B
$B>l9g$K$O!"(Bteikade $B$N%=!<%9$K(B patch $B$r$"$F$k$3$H$G!"K\>c32$r2sHr$9$k$3(B
$B$H$,$G$-$^$9!#(B
($B6a$$$&$A$K(B teikade $B$N3+H/85$K5[<}$5$l$k$H;W$$$^$9(B)

$B0J2<$K(B patch $B$H$=$N<j=g$r<($7$^$9!#(B(teikade $B$rE83+$7$?%G%#%l%/%H%j$r(B
$TEIKADE $B$H$7$F@bL@$7$F$$$^$9(B)

1. $B0J2<$N(B patch $B$r%U%!%$%k$KJ]B8$7$F!"(Bpatch $B$r$"$F$^$9!#(B
  % cd $TEIKADE/src/teikade/sys
  % patch < '$BJ]B8$7$?%U%!%$%kL>(B'

----- patch ($B$3$3$+$i(B) ---------------------------------------------
*** SystemManager.java.orig	Thu Mar  5 15:29:13 1998
--- SystemManager.java	Thu Mar  5 15:30:58 1998
***************
*** 47,53 ****
  
      static {
  	String os = System.getProperty("os.name");
! 	if (os.equals("Solaris") || os.equals("Linux") || os.equals("UXP/DS")) {
  	    onSolaris = true;
  	} else if (os.equals("Windows 95")) {
  	    onWin32 = true;
--- 47,53 ----
  
      static {
  	String os = System.getProperty("os.name");
! 	if (os.equals("Solaris") || os.equals("Linux") || os.equals("UXP/DS") || os.equals("FreeBSD")) {
  	    onSolaris = true;
  	} else if (os.equals("Windows 95")) {
  	    onWin32 = true;
***************
*** 60,66 ****
  	String version = System.getProperty("java.version");
  	if (version.startsWith("1.1")
  	||  version.startsWith("jvm11_")
! 	||  version.startsWith("sbb:")) {
  	    onJDK1_1 = true;
  	}
  	CLASSPATH = System.getProperty("java.class.path");
--- 60,67 ----
  	String version = System.getProperty("java.version");
  	if (version.startsWith("1.1")
  	||  version.startsWith("jvm11_")
! 	||  version.startsWith("sbb:")
! 	||	version.startsWith("jdk1.1")) {
  	    onJDK1_1 = true;
  	}
  	CLASSPATH = System.getProperty("java.class.path");
----- patch ($B$3$3$^$G(B) ---------------------------------------------

2. SystemManager.java $B$r%3%s%Q%$%k$7$^$9!#(B
  % javac SystemManager.java

3. classes.zip $B$N(B SystemManager.class $B$rF~$l49$($^$9!#(B
  % cd $TEIKADE/src
  % mv ../classes.zip .
  % zip -u classes teikade/sys/SystemManager.class
  % mv classes.zip ../

(zip $B$OI8=`%3%^%s%I$G$O$J$$$N$G!"(Bpackages/ports $B$+$i%$%s%9%H!<%k$7$F$*(B
$B$$$F$/$@$5$$(B)

$B0J>e$G$9!#(B
------------------------------------------------------------

$BN)$A>e$2$F$_$?46A[$O$H$$$&$H!"$d$C$Q$7$A$g$C$H=E$a$G$9$M$'!D(B
$B2H$N(B K5-133PR $B$J$i$^$!$$$$$G$9$1$I!"2q<R$N(B P54C-75 $B$8$c!"$A$H?I$=$&$+(B
$B$J!D(B

$B$"$H!"%=!<%9$,$J$$$H(B class $B$N2r@O$b(B javap $B$N$h$&$K$O$7$F$/$l$J$$$N$G!"(B
$BI8=`%/%i%9$r;2>H$7$?$1$l$P(B src.zip $B$r?-D9$7$F$*$/$+!"(BAPI Reference $B$r(B
$BMQ0U$7$F$*$+$J$$$H%@%a$_$?$$$G$9$M!#(B

$B$H$$$&46$8$G$7$?!#(B
$B0J>e$4;XE&2<$5$C$?J}!9$K46<U$7$^$9!#(B

      _/_/_/_/_/_/_/_/_/_/_/_/_/_/_/_/_/_/_/_/_/_/
     _/   $B7'^<?5Li(B                             _/
    _/      e-mail: kumabu@t3.rim.or.jp       _/
   _/_/_/_/_/_/_/_/_/_/_/_/_/_/_/_/_/_/_/_/_/_/
